Stars give for location, free parking and the pool. But this is far from a 4 star hotel as claimed. Broken fixtures in room, very small 'family room', paper cups, no amenities in room, no air conditioning, luckily facing the sea so we could open the door all night for fresh air even in November it was stuffy. I wouldn't be happy to stay in summer. Restaurant was 'full' at 8pm on our arrival, despite seeing many empty tables after a long journey with 2 kids. To be greeted rude restaurant staff and told we can either pay €10 per person for room service on top of outrageous menu prices or to 'try another restaurant in town' was not a great start! When we said, we have just arrived and checked in, how can we feed our kids? No help. When we discovered the room does not have any ar fridge (4 stars??) We then has to eat all of our perishable snacks we had anyway, so it was cheese, beer and yoghurt for dinner on our bed, plus a €10 kids meal of ham and mashed potato (plus €10 for room service)! The room had a broken toilet roll holder, logged sin, very basic toiletries, 2 paper cups, some instant coffee and a kettle. The 'family room' at a cost of €650 for 3 nights was tiny. The kids single beds were basically in a hallway space, no window or air flow at all. Ok for winter but would be horrible in summer. Very small shower only bathroom, and separate toilet with automatic light that lights up the whole room when the door is opened, urgh. Luckily there was good storage once we had unpacked, but barely room for a suitcase to be opened on the floor. The pool and spa area was nice, but acces was denied during g 'lessons' twice a day and could only be accessed with a headcap on (€5 if you didn't have one), no boardshorts allowed, so husband couldn't use the pool, kids ok without a cap otherwise we would have been fuming. After the experience with the restaurant and expense of the room, another €10 for caps for the adult to take a quick dip wasn't worth it. Couldn't secure a booking at the spa, after enquiring at the desk, no treatment treatment menu, had to be emailed, after responding to request a booking for the following day, no response. Overall, very disappointed with out stay, almost left on the first night, but it was my 40th birthday the next day and had a haircut booked otherwise we would have moved on to somewhere else. The redeeming features were the location, beachfront, lovely walk in the afternoon, the town was well appointed and easily accessed and free parking, hence the 3 stars.
